How courts have described this case

Verbatim parenthetical descriptions written by other courts when citing this decision. Ranked by citation-network relevance.

  • Rule 60(b) never intended to provide “a means for postponing or escaping that [appeals time period] expiration.”
  • mistake of law should have been urged on direct appeal, not by Rule 60(b) motion
  • “Once the bankruptcy was dismissed, a bankruptcy court no longer had power to order the stay or to award damages allegedly attributable to its vacation. A remand by us to the bankruptcy court would therefore be useless.”
